Shrinkage Compensation Calculator
Oversize a model from a measured linear shrinkage rate so the cooled part approaches its target dimension.
How the calculation works
Designed dimension = target dimension ÷ (1 − shrinkage rate). Dividing, rather than simply adding the percentage, compensates against the oversized starting dimension.
How to use this result
Measure shrinkage using a representative calibration part printed in the same orientation, material, settings, and cooling conditions. X, Y, and Z may require different measured rates.
Example
For a 100 mm target with 0.6% measured shrinkage, design slightly above 100.6 mm because shrinkage applies to the larger starting size.
